Robert Levy

Robert Levy Email and Phone Number

Senior Software Engineer | Clojure / data-oriented / functional programming | AI and machine learning
Robert Levy's Location
Oakland, California, United States, United States
Robert Levy's Contact Details
About Robert Levy

I am a highly experienced software engineer specializing in functional and data-oriented programming (professional Clojure developer since 2010) and AI / machine learning. My strengths include designing, implementing, and maintaining robust and scalable systems, and solving complex technical challenges that demand leadership, collaboration, and communication skills. I have achieved success in building and delivering high-impact feature sets and products such as LLM-based summarization and ranking for malware threats at Cisco, a custom payouts system at Starcity, and TalkIQ's real-time intelligence augmentation interface for sales reps and customer service agents.My fascination with software development started early, with my childhood love of computer programming. I began programming in BASIC on a Commodore 64, later moving on to QuickBasic and Pascal. When choosing a college, I was drawn to SUNY Oswego's multi-disciplinary cognitive science program. I became their first cognitive science graduate, and my thesis was an AI model of creativity using recurrent neural nets.Initially I worked primarily in Perl, Python, and PHP, striving for simple, readable, and expressive code. Inspired by Common Lisp and the works of Paul Graham, I embraced functional programming in Perl. I'm drawn to functional and data-oriented programming because it empowers programmers to be more expressive and productive. This focus on expressiveness, alongside my interest in ergonomic design and AI augmenting the intelligence of users, has been a recurring theme in my career.The 2010s saw Clojure becoming central to my work. I love its pragmatism, simplicity, expressive power owing to its immutable data structures and functional idiom, and robust production-quality performance. I grew my expertise in distributed systems software architecture, through a series of substantive experiences building service-oriented architectures with REST, GraphQL, and Kafka, and I continue to learn and deepen my skill set in this area of interest. I likewise honed my front-end skills, as an early adopter of ClojureScript and using React, Reagent, Re-frame, Om, and Node.js. My passion for machine learning and AI continues, both professionally and personally. More details on my professional achievements can be found in the work experience sections of my resume.I am open to new opportunities and I am excited about contributing to a team that is pushing the boundaries of applying generative AI technology in my next role. Please feel free to connect on Linkedin or send an email to rplevy@gmail.com.

Robert Levy's Current Company Details

Senior Software Engineer | Clojure / data-oriented / functional programming | AI and machine learning
Robert Levy Work Experience Details
  • Cisco
    Senior Clojure Developer
    Cisco Feb 2020 - Nov 2024
    San Jose, Ca, Us
    Played a pivotal role in enhancing Cisco's SecureX platform, contributing to security solutions development, module integration, and innovative uses of generative AI. Focused on optimizing security workflows and improving user experiences through architectural design and hands-on development of key features.▪ Enhanced threat detection by introducing LLM-based summarization and ranking for malware threats, resulting in new productdevelopment for the XDR team.▪ Streamlined user credential management across modules by designing and implementing hierarchical module support, improvingusability and efficiency.▪ Drove architectural design and development of SecureX modules, collaborating with multiple teams for product integration.▪ Improved user experience through creation of new APIs and dashboard tiles for integrated modules, elevating platform utility.▪ Guided and mentored new engineers, fostering growth into productive team members.▪ Championed cross-team collaborations, ensuring delivery of integrated platform features and maintaining high operationalstandards.
  • Starcity
    Principal Software Engineer
    Starcity Apr 2019 - Jan 2020
    San Francisco, Ca, Us
    Served as technical lead for payments and operations teams, driving custom Stripe payouts and key mobile app features development. Oversaw high-priority production projects, delivering solutions under tight timelines and providing crucial support for property management and accounting operations.▪ Delivered timely payouts by completing implementation of custom Stripe-based system after taking over full project responsibility▪ Released mobile app with integrated push notification system by researching options, creating detailed system design, and implementing end-to-end solution.▪ Enhanced operational support by developing property management and accounting features within legacy Clojure stack, increasing platform functionality.▪ Led post-reorganization technical operations, providing critical production support and driving development for memberoperations.
  • Dividend Finance
    Senior Software Engineer
    Dividend Finance Apr 2018 - Mar 2019
    ▪ Improved user engagement by developing the ClojureScript portal using re-frame and material UI, enhancing financing solutions.▪ Streamlined financing operations by creating APIs for solar and home improvement integration with legacy systems, boosting operational efficiency.▪ Strengthened backend support through development of Clojure APIs, ensuring secure and scalable solutions for financing needs.▪ Collaborated cross-functionally to align software development with business goals, optimizing platform delivery for target users.
  • Talkiq / Dialpad
    Frontend Developer (Clojurescript)
    Talkiq / Dialpad Aug 2017 - Apr 2018
    ▪ Improved user experience by implementing real-time and post-call features for Omni product using ClojureScript with Om/React.▪ Strengthened product design by contributing to feature interactions and enhancing user workflows through design processes.▪ Elevated code quality and reliability by establishing and refining testing practices across frontend systems.▪ Optimized product features by integrating user feedback into design and development processes.
  • Funding Circle Us
    Senior Engineer
    Funding Circle Us Sep 2015 - Aug 2017
    Denver, Colorado, Us
    ▪ Increased platform reliability by designing and implementing distributed stream processing systems with Clojure, Kafka, and Mesos.▪ Developed dynamic UI applications using ClojureScript and Reagent/Re-frame, improving user interaction and interface performance.▪ Optimized testing processes by creating robust tools and strategies for end-to-end testing of stream processing topologies.▪ Enhanced system scalability and stability by engineering resilient distributed architecture aligned with business growth needs.
  • Sonian
    Software Engineer
    Sonian Jan 2014 - Dec 2014
    Waltham, Massachusetts, Us
    ▪ Enhanced data retrieval by creating and maintaining search DSL using Elasticsearch for complex search-related services.▪ Improved system performance by developing robust email archiving and metadata solutions utilizing Clojure and Datomic.▪ Ensured system reliability by managing and optimizing Elasticsearch maintenance for scalable, efficient search operations.▪ Boosted service functionality through development of advanced search features tailored to user needs and system requirements.
  • Runa, Inc. / Staples Innovation Lab
    Sr. Software Engineer In Predictive Modeling
    Runa, Inc. / Staples Innovation Lab Mar 2013 - Oct 2013
    Mountain View, Ca, Us
    Senior Software Engineer▪ Increased customer sales lift by designing and implementing high-performance ML algorithms using Clojure.▪ Improved modularity and scalability by re-architecting predictive modeling infrastructure, enhancing overall system performance.▪ Optimized promo engine services, meeting stringent latency and load requirements and contributing to acquisition by Staples.▪ Boosted e-commerce customer sales by extracting, developing features, tuning models, and implementing precision algorithms.
  • Draker Laboratories
    Software Engineer, Data Team
    Draker Laboratories Feb 2012 - Feb 2013
    Burlington, Vt, Us
  • Akamai Technologies
    Software Engineer
    Akamai Technologies Aug 2010 - Dec 2011
    Cambridge, Ma, Us
  • Brandeis University
    Web Application Developer
    Brandeis University Jun 2008 - Aug 2010
    Waltham, Ma, Us
  • Massachusetts General Hospital
    Research Assistant / Programmer
    Massachusetts General Hospital Jan 2007 - Nov 2007
    Boston, Ma, Us
  • Courier Systems, Wilmington, Ma
    Desktop & Web Developer
    Courier Systems, Wilmington, Ma May 2002 - Dec 2006
  • State University Of New York At Oswego
    Research Assistant
    State University Of New York At Oswego Dec 2000 - Mar 2001
    Oswego, Ny, Us
  • Air Force Research Laboratory
    Web Developer (College Internship)
    Air Force Research Laboratory Jul 1997 - Aug 1999
    Wright-Patterson Afb, Oh, Us

Robert Levy Skills

Clojure Machine Learning Elasticsearch Rabbitmq Perl Python Java Apache Cassandra Hbase Mysql Postgresql Natural Language Processing Emacs Lisp Common Lisp Datomic Cascalog Cucumber Clojurescript Javascript Css Html Tcl Matlab Subversion Perforce Git Unix Shell Scripting Regular Expressions Chef Ldap Jetty Interbase/firebird Db2/sql Oracle Latex Neural Networks Evolutionary Computation Agile Oauth

Robert Levy Education Details

  • State University Of New York At Oswego
    State University Of New York At Oswego
    Cognitive Science & Linguistics

Frequently Asked Questions about Robert Levy

What is Robert Levy's role at the current company?

Robert Levy's current role is Senior Software Engineer | Clojure / data-oriented / functional programming | AI and machine learning.

What is Robert Levy's email address?

Robert Levy's email address is rl****@****sco.com

What is Robert Levy's direct phone number?

Robert Levy's direct phone number is +161772*****

What schools did Robert Levy attend?

Robert Levy attended State University Of New York At Oswego.

What are some of Robert Levy's interests?

Robert Levy has interest in Functional Programming, Clojure, Mobile, Domain Specific Languages (Dsl), Lisp, Declarative Programming, Security, Machine Learning, Semantic Web, Computational Linguistics.

What skills is Robert Levy known for?

Robert Levy has skills like Clojure, Machine Learning, Elasticsearch, Rabbitmq, Perl, Python, Java, Apache, Cassandra, Hbase, Mysql, Postgresql.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.